package config
import (
"fmt"
"os"
"path/filepath"
"testing"
"github.com/spf13/viper"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
"github.com/stretchr/testify/suite"
"github.com/alcionai/corso/src/internal/tester"
"github.com/alcionai/corso/src/pkg/account"
"github.com/alcionai/corso/src/pkg/credentials"
"github.com/alcionai/corso/src/pkg/storage"
)
const (
configFileTemplate = `
` + BucketNameKey + ` = '%s'
` + EndpointKey + ` = 's3.amazonaws.com'
` + PrefixKey + ` = 'test-prefix/'
` + StorageProviderTypeKey + ` = 'S3'
` + AccountProviderTypeKey + ` = 'M365'
` + AzureTenantIDKey + ` = '%s'
` + DisableTLSKey + ` = 'false'
` + DisableTLSVerificationKey + ` = 'false'
`
)
type ConfigSuite struct {
suite.Suite
}
func TestConfigSuite(t *testing.T) {
suite.Run(t, new(ConfigSuite))
}
func (suite *ConfigSuite) TestReadRepoConfigBasic() {
var (
t = suite.T()
vpr = viper.New()
)
const (
b = "read-repo-config-basic-bucket"
tID = "6f34ac30-8196-469b-bf8f-d83deadbbbba"
)
// Generate test config file
testConfigData := fmt.Sprintf(configFileTemplate, b, tID)
testConfigFilePath := filepath.Join(t.TempDir(), "corso.toml")
err := os.WriteFile(testConfigFilePath, []byte(testConfigData), 0o700)
require.NoError(t, err)
// Configure viper to read test config file
vpr.SetConfigFile(testConfigFilePath)
// Read and validate config
require.NoError(t, vpr.ReadInConfig(), "reading repo config")
s3Cfg, err := s3ConfigsFromViper(vpr)
require.NoError(t, err)
assert.Equal(t, b, s3Cfg.Bucket)
m365, err := m365ConfigsFromViper(vpr)
require.NoError(t, err)
assert.Equal(t, tID, m365.AzureTenantID)
}
func (suite *ConfigSuite) TestWriteReadConfig() {
var (
t = suite.T()
vpr = viper.New()
)
const (
bkt = "write-read-config-bucket"
tid = "3c0748d2-470e-444c-9064-1268e52609d5"
)
// Configure viper to read test config file
testConfigFilePath := filepath.Join(t.TempDir(), "corso.toml")
require.NoError(t, initWithViper(vpr, testConfigFilePath), "initializing repo config")
s3Cfg := storage.S3Config{Bucket: bkt, DoNotUseTLS: true, DoNotVerifyTLS: true}
m365 := account.M365Config{AzureTenantID: tid}
require.NoError(t, writeRepoConfigWithViper(vpr, s3Cfg, m365), "writing repo config")
require.NoError(t, vpr.ReadInConfig(), "reading repo config")
readS3Cfg, err := s3ConfigsFromViper(vpr)
require.NoError(t, err)
assert.Equal(t, readS3Cfg.Bucket, s3Cfg.Bucket)
assert.Equal(t, readS3Cfg.DoNotUseTLS, s3Cfg.DoNotUseTLS)
assert.Equal(t, readS3Cfg.DoNotVerifyTLS, s3Cfg.DoNotVerifyTLS)
readM365, err := m365ConfigsFromViper(vpr)
require.NoError(t, err)
assert.Equal(t, readM365.AzureTenantID, m365.AzureTenantID)
}
func (suite *ConfigSuite) TestMustMatchConfig() {
var (
t = suite.T()
vpr = viper.New()
)
const (
bkt = "must-match-config-bucket"
tid = "dfb12063-7598-458b-85ab-42352c5c25e2"
)
// Configure viper to read test config file
testConfigFilePath := filepath.Join(t.TempDir(), "corso.toml")
require.NoError(t, initWithViper(vpr, testConfigFilePath), "initializing repo config")
s3Cfg := storage.S3Config{Bucket: bkt}
m365 := account.M365Config{AzureTenantID: tid}
require.NoError(t, writeRepoConfigWithViper(vpr, s3Cfg, m365), "writing repo config")
require.NoError(t, vpr.ReadInConfig(), "reading repo config")
table := []struct {
name string
input map[string]string
errCheck assert.ErrorAssertionFunc
}{
{
name: "full match",
input: map[string]string{
storage.Bucket: bkt,
account.AzureTenantID: tid,
},
errCheck: assert.NoError,
},
{
name: "empty values",
input: map[string]string{
storage.Bucket: "",
account.AzureTenantID: "",
},
errCheck: assert.NoError,
},
{
name: "no overrides",
input: map[string]string{},
errCheck: assert.NoError,
},
{
name: "nil map",
input: nil,
errCheck: assert.NoError,
},
{
name: "no recognized keys",
input: map[string]string{
"fnords": "smurfs",
"nonsense": "",
},
errCheck: assert.NoError,
},
{
name: "mismatch",
input: map[string]string{
storage.Bucket: tid,
account.AzureTenantID: bkt,
},
errCheck: assert.Error,
},
}
for _, test := range table {
t.Run(test.name, func(t *testing.T) {
test.errCheck(t, mustMatchConfig(vpr, test.input))
})
}
}
